Abstract

Geomembrane protection materials should be considered in design if geomembranes are to properly serve the role of barrier materials. The type, thickness and properties of the required protection material are in significant need of a rational design method. This series of three papers provides a design method for the inclusion of geomembrane protection materials, geotextiles in particular. Part I focuses on theory, Part II focuses on experiments, and this paper, Part III, focuses on design examples and presents a comparison of results presented in Parts I and II. The design developed in Part II is used in this paper to provide several numerical examples that highlight the different strategies used in Germany and in the USA for the selection of protection geotextiles. This paper also includes a number of design charts for a wide variety of practical situations. Finally, puncture resistance results for a geomembrane with different types of protection materials (other than virgin polymer nonwoven needle punched geotextiles) are presented in the Appendix. The design procedures presented result in a site specific and material specific factor of safety.
